An outside-barycenter lesson
An outside-barycenter lesson starts when you show that ~2,110 km from Pluto's center exceeds the 1188.3 km mean radius, so the green marker sits in empty space between the worlds.
Mass, period, and lock figures from New Horizons / JPL
Published figures land cleanly here: radii 1188.3 km / 606 km, masses 1.303e22 kg / 1.586e21 kg (~8.2:1), separation ~19,591 km, period 6.387 days, both tidally locked.
